Complete One highlight the 6 differences between great and bad leaders

Newcastle-based, direct marketing and sales specialists, Complete One believe that strong leadership is the foundation for success in any area of life. Here they have highlighted the 6 differences between great and bad leaders.

Complete One believe that excelling in leadership will result in success. As an expanding company that frequently talent scout, one of the main transferable skills they look for is the ability to lead. Here, Complete One examines the 6 differences between great and bad leaders.
1. Great leaders see potential in people and can nurture it.
Bad leaders fail to identify potential, and instead only focus on the negative, and find fault.
2. Great leaders are always positive and encourage others to do better.
Bad leaders are negative, and are always blaming others for their failures rather than taking responsibility,
3. Great leaders motivate and inspire people to learn, grow and develop.
Bad leaders are only interested in their own progression; they aren’t concerned about the growth of others.
4. Great leaders have the ability to recognise people's strengths and place the best people in the right positions to help them perform well.
Bad leaders exploit people to the benefit of themselves.
5. Great leaders are open to new ideas and are always looking to innovate and improve.
Bad leaders fear change and are unwilling to take any risks.
6. Great leaders appreciate the efforts of their team and recognise and reward them for those efforts.
Bad leaders don’t value their team, and they have the attitude that every member of their team is replaceable.
